What is the Practical AI Center-of-Excellence Building course about?
AI programs in government and public-serving organizations frequently underdeliver because they lack a centralized operating model. Without a clear Center of Excellence, teams struggle to align on standards, share resources, or scale successes. This leads to duplicated effort, compliance gaps, and eroded stakeholder trust, even when technical capabilities exist.
